Abstract
A control system and method maintains engine air/fuel operation near stoichiometry (104-178) in response to exhaust gas oxygen sensors (44,52) positioned both upstream and downstream of a catalytic converter (50). A non-catalytic exhaust gas oxygen sensor (54), having non-catalytic electrode, is positioned downstream of the converter (50) and its output voltage (Vo) monitored. Pumping current (Ip) is applied to an electrode of the non-catalytic sensor at a predetermined magnitude (IPREF) from a pumping current generator (56). When the output voltage (Vo) is detected at a predetermined high voltage range (302-318) an indication of degraded converter efficiency is provided (320).
